Output 9c4988143424c16aed484c74865374f86f4fc39c63e56602d52e3e8346182fcd:23

value
50565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e0b265d71f1c848b045211c4b9bc6289081c4f OP_EQUAL
address
328ooXHpUAziny5UJ6s2UPRNYzTdaeMvxK
transaction
9c4988143424c16aed484c74865374f86f4fc39c63e56602d52e3e8346182fcd
spent
true